Heparin and thrombosis prophylaxis

Are medical thrombosis prophylaxis stockings necessary at all if the patient is being treated with heparin?

A combination of physical and pharmaceutical measures is almost always recommended. Apart from a few exceptions, providing patients with thrombosis prophylaxis stockings and prescribing an anticoagulant (e.g. heparin) is the most reliable way of reducing the incidence of venous thrombosis.
